Purpose and Common Applications

The KS368 sensor plays a critical role in emission control and engine management by detecting engine knock or detonation. This information allows the engine control unit (ECU) to adjust ignition timing and prevent engine damage. It is commonly used in the following scenarios:

  • Engine knocking or pinging during acceleration
  • Reduced fuel efficiency or performance issues
  • Check engine light triggered by knock sensor fault codes
  • Irregular engine timing or misfires
  • Emission control system malfunctions related to detonation detection

Installation Notes and Tips

When installing the Standard Ignition KS368 sensor, ensure the mounting surface is clean and free of debris for optimal sensor performance. Use the original mounting bolts or appropriate hardware since mounting hardware is not included. Connect the rectangular female connector securely to avoid electrical issues. Proper torque specifications should be followed to prevent sensor damage or improper readings.
